GLOBAL EYES ON KERALA: GREENSTORM’S JURY OF VISIONARIES

Share
Share

The Greenstorm Global Photography Festival’s international jury, featuring Charlie Waite, Latika Nath, and Nick Hall, adds global credibility to Kerala’s conservation movement. With founder Dileep Narayanan’s vision and UNCCD partnership, the festival blends artistry, authenticity, and purpose, inspiring environmental awareness and action through photography across 177 countries.

The Greenstorm Global Photography Festival has always been about more than images; it is about credibility, artistry, and the power of photography to stir conscience. That credibility is amplified by its international jury, a panel of celebrated photographers whose collective vision ensures the festival’s work resonates far beyond Kerala.

Charlie Waite, one of Britain’s most distinguished landscape photographers, lends his painterly eye and reputation for elevating landscapes into fine art. His presence signals Greenstorm’s seriousness in balancing aesthetic excellence with environmental urgency. Latika Nath, India’s pioneering wildlife photographer and conservationist, brings a fierce advocacy for biodiversity, reminding audiences that conservation is not abstract but deeply personal. Nick Hall, acclaimed for his environmental and cultural landscapes, adds an American perspective, ensuring the festival’s reach is truly global.

Together, these figures form a Grand Jury that does more than select winners; they validate the festival’s mission. Their stature reassures participants that their work is judged not only for technical brilliance but for its ability to move hearts and minds. In an era of synthetic imagery, this jury insists on authenticity, reinforcing Greenstorm’s role as a global conservation movement born in Kerala.

Adding a deeply personal note, Dileep Narayanan, Founder & Managing Trustee of the Greenstorm Foundation, reflects: “I still remember when Greenstorm was a modest idea, a way to get more people to notice the land beneath their feet. Watching it grow into a festival that the UNCCD chooses to platform on a global stage is not something I take lightly, and it is not something I did alone.” Narayanan, who is also Founder & Managing Director of Organic BPS, a brand purpose consultancy, underscores the collective effort behind Greenstorm’s rise.

By assembling such a distinguished panel and combining it with visionary leadership, Greenstorm demonstrates that photography is not just about capturing beauty—it is about shaping narratives that matter. The jury’s international voices echo the festival’s central message: that a single image can awaken global consciousness and inspire action for the planet.
